Role-Based Access Control (RBAC)

Implementing Role-Based Access Control, or RBAC, is a powerful way to streamline access management. Instead of assigning permissions to individual users, RBAC assigns permissions to roles. Users are then assigned to these roles, automatically inheriting the associated permissions. This simplifies administration, reduces the risk of errors, and ensures consistency across the organization. For example, a “Content Editor” role might have permission to create and edit website content, but not to modify database settings. A “Developer” role might have broader access to the codebase but limited access to production servers. Clearly defined roles and associated permissions vastly improve security posture and ensure appropriate access levels are maintained across all web assets.

Securing Your Website with Regular Software Updates

Keeping your website software up-to-date is one of the most critical, yet often overlooked, security practices. Software updates frequently include security patches that address newly discovered vulnerabilities. These vulnerabilities can be exploited by attackers to gain access to your website, steal data, or disrupt service. This applies not only to your core website platform (like WordPress, Drupal, or Joomla) but also to all plugins, themes, and third-party extensions. Automated updating features, where available, can greatly simplify this process. However, it's also important to test updates in a staging environment before deploying them to your live website to ensure compatibility and prevent unforeseen issues. A delayed patch is a missed opportunity to protect your digital assets.

The Importance of Vulnerability Scanning

Vulnerability scanning tools automatically scan your website for known security weaknesses. These tools can identify outdated software, misconfigurations, and other potential security flaws. While vulnerability scanning isn’t a substitute for regular security audits, it provides a valuable layer of protection and helps prioritize remediation efforts. Numerous commercial and open-source vulnerability scanners are available, each with its own strengths and weaknesses. Choose a scanner that is appropriate for your website’s size, complexity, and security requirements. Regularly scheduled scans, combined with prompt patching of identified vulnerabilities, significantly reduce your attack surface and minimize the risk of a successful exploit.

Implementing a Web Application Firewall (WAF)

A Web Application Firewall (WAF) acts as a protective barrier between your website and the internet, filtering out malicious traffic and preventing attacks such as SQL injection, cross-site scripting (XSS), and distributed denial-of-service (DDoS) attacks. Unlike traditional firewalls, which operate at the network level, WAFs analyze HTTP traffic and specifically target web application vulnerabilities. WAFs can be deployed as hardware appliances, software solutions, or cloud-based services. Cloud-based WAFs offer the advantage of scalability and ease of management, while hardware and software WAFs provide greater control and customization options. Configuring a WAF requires careful consideration of your website’s specific needs and security requirements.

WAF Rule Customization

A WAF’s effectiveness is largely dependent on the quality of its rule set. While most WAFs come with pre-defined rules to protect against common attacks, these rules may not be sufficient to address your website’s unique vulnerabilities. Customizing the WAF rules allows you to fine-tune its protection and block specific types of malicious traffic. This often involves analyzing your website’s logs, identifying patterns of attack, and creating custom rules to mitigate those threats. However, overly aggressive rules can result in false positives, blocking legitimate traffic. Therefore, it’s important to carefully test and monitor your WAF rules to ensure they are working as intended. A well-configured WAF is a vital component of a comprehensive website security strategy.

The Importance of Return to Player (RTP)

A key metric that players should familiarize themselves with is Return to Player (RTP). RTP represents the percentage of wagered money that a particular game is expected to return to players over a long period of time. A higher RTP generally indicates a better chance of winning, although it’s important to remember that RTP is a theoretical calculation and doesn’t guarantee specific outcomes in any given session. Different games have vastly different RTPs; for example, certain video poker variations can have RTPs exceeding 99%, while some slot machines may have RTPs as low as 85%. Players should research the RTP of a game before playing and choose games that offer more favorable odds. Always consider RTP in conjunction with game volatility, which describes the frequency and size of payouts.

Game Approximate RTP House Edge
Blackjack (Basic Strategy) 99.5% 0.5%
Baccarat (Banker Bet) 98.94% 1.06%
Craps (Pass Line Bet) 98.6% 1.4%
European Roulette 97.3% 2.7%
American Roulette 94.74% 5.26%

Understanding these foundational concepts – probability, odds, and RTP – forms the bedrock of informed gambling. It allows players to move beyond blind faith and approach casino games with a more analytical and strategic mindset, increasing their enjoyment and potentially improving their outcomes.

Understanding Wagering Requirements and Game Contributions

Wagering requirements are typically expressed as a multiple of the bonus amount. For example,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means you must wager 30 times the bonus amount before you can withdraw winnings. It's also important to consider the time limit attached to bonuses, as they often expire after a certain period. Failing to meet the wagering requirement within the time limit will result in the loss of the bonus and any associated winnings. Players should also be aware of maximum bet limits associated with bonuses; exceeding these limits may void the bonus. Scrutinizing these details allows you to determine the true value of a bonus and avoid potential disappointment.

The Role of Syndicates and Pooling Resources

To improve their odds, many lottery players participate in syndicates or pools, where they combine their money to purchase a larger number of tickets, thereby increasing their chances of winning. While this strategy doesn’t guarantee a win, it does enhance the probability of having a winning ticket. However, it’s crucial to establish clear agreements upfront among syndicate members regarding the sharing of winnings. These agreements should outline how tickets are purchased, how winnings will be distributed, and how potential disputes will be resolved. A well-defined and documented agreement can prevent conflicts and ensure a fair outcome for everyone involved. The legal aspects of lottery syndicates can vary by jurisdiction, so it's wise to consult with legal counsel if substantial sums of money are involved.

Lottery Type Typical Jackpot Odds of Winning Jackpot (approx.)
Powerball (US) $100 million+ 1 in 292.2 million
Mega Millions (US) $80 million+ 1 in 302.6 million
EuroMillions (Europe) €20 million+ 1 in 139.8 million
National Lottery (UK) £10 million+ 1 in 45.1 million

The table above illustrates the substantial jackpots offered by some of the world’s most popular lotteries, along with the incredibly long odds associated with winning. These numbers highlight the importance of responsible play and understanding that the lottery should be viewed as entertainment rather than a reliable financial strategy.
